My Buying Guides on Fabric Glue For Leather
When I first started working on leather projects, I quickly realized that choosing the right fabric glue for leather was crucial. Not all adhesives work well with leather, and using the wrong one can lead to weak bonds or even damage. Here’s what I’ve learned along the way to help you pick the best fabric glue for leather.
1. Understand the Type of Leather You’re Working With
Leather varies in texture, thickness, and finish. I always consider whether my leather is genuine, faux, suede, or nubuck. Some glues work better on smooth surfaces like genuine or faux leather, while others are specially formulated for porous surfaces like suede. Knowing your leather type helps narrow down your glue options.
2. Look for Flexibility in the Glue
Leather is flexible and bends frequently, so the glue I choose needs to maintain a strong bond without becoming brittle or cracking over time. I prefer fabric glues that dry clear and remain flexible. This way, my leather projects stay durable and comfortable to use.
3. Consider Water Resistance
Since leather items like shoes, bags, or jackets can be exposed to moisture, I always pick a glue that offers good water resistance. This helps ensure the bond holds strong even if the leather gets wet or humid.
4. Ease of Application and Drying Time
I find that a fabric glue with a precision applicator tip makes it easier to apply neatly, especially for small or detailed leather repairs. Also, I look for glues with reasonable drying times — not too fast that I can’t reposition, but not so slow that I have to wait hours before handling the item.
5. Non-Toxic and Odor Considerations
Since I often work indoors, I prefer glues that are non-toxic and have low odor. This makes the crafting experience more pleasant and safer, especially if I’m working on projects around others.
6. Read Reviews and Test Before Full Use
Before committing to a glue, I usually read other users’ reviews about how well it bonds leather specifically. If possible, I test the glue on a small scrap piece of leather to see how it performs — checking bond strength, appearance, and flexibility.
7. Brand Reputation and Price
While I don’t always go for the most expensive option, I find that reputable brands often provide better quality adhesives designed for leather. It’s worth investing a little more for a product that delivers lasting results.
